Overview
This class describes where to place ticks on the target axis and how to label them.

Class Method Details
.tweak_format_string(str) ⇒ Object
84 85 86 |
# File 'lib/ctioga2/graphics/styles/ticks.rb', line 84 def self.tweak_format_string(str) return str.gsub("%b", "%2$").gsub("%p", "%3$d") end |
